Imphal, May 30:
A retired MCS officer was arrested by the sleuths of Vigilance Department yesterday in connection with the case of misusing a sum of Rs 35 lakhs sanctioned during 1999-2000 for the purpose of computerising theland records in 27 SDC/SDO offices under the Directorate of Settlement and Land Records.
According to a reliable source, retired Deputy Settlement Officer A Sukumar allegedly submitted the bills without procuring the required materials for the computerisation of the land records.
He was later produced in the law Court and granted bail on medical ground.
The FIR registered against him is under 4(10) 04 VPs, U/s 406/420/468/471/120 (b) IPC 13(1) (c), PC Act.
AE Joykumar and SO who surrendered to the Vigilance on May 11 are presently out on anticipatory bail.
